Browse services
your locationFind care near me
Search

Flu shot near me
in Pegram, TN

Hours
Rating
Distance
Add location icon

Own a clinic? Add your location.

Help patients book appointments with you on Solv. It's free!

Add location

20 instant-book locations

400 Sam Ridley Pkwy W, Smyrna, TN 37167400 Sam Ridley Pkwy W
Open until 7:30 pm
  • Mon 8:00 am - 7:30 pm
  • Tue 8:00 am - 7:30 pm
  • Wed 8:00 am - 7:30 pm
  • Thu 8:00 am - 7:30 pm
  • Fri 8:00 am - 6:30 pm
  • Sat 9:30 am - 5:00 pm
  • Sun 9:30 am - 5:00 pm
Walgreens Healthcare Clinic - 400 Sam Ridley Pkwy W, Smyrna
Visit Clinic

14299 Old Nashville Hwy, Smyrna, TN 3716714299 Old Nashville Hwy
Open until 7:00 pm
  • Mon 8:00 am - 7:00 pm
  • Tue 8:00 am - 7:00 pm
  • Wed 8:00 am - 7:00 pm
  • Thu 8:00 am - 7:00 pm
  • Fri 8:00 am - 7:00 pm
  • Sat 9:00 am - 5:30 pm
  • Sun 9:00 am - 4:30 pm
MinuteClinic® at CVS®, Old Nashville Hwy, Smyrna - 14299 Old Nashville Hwy, Smyrna

AVAILABLE TIMES

Visit Clinic

903 Memorial Blvd, Springfield, TN 37172903 Memorial Blvd
Open until 5:00 pm
  • Mon 9:00 am - 5:00 pm
  • Tue 9:00 am - 5:00 pm
  • WedClosed
  • Thu 9:00 am - 5:00 pm
  • FriClosed
  • Sat 9:00 am - 4:30 pm
  • Sun 9:00 am - 4:30 pm
MinuteClinic® at CVS®, Memorial Blvd, Springfield - 903 Memorial Blvd, Springfield

AVAILABLE TIMES

Visit Clinic

291 Indian Lake Blvd, Hendersonville, TN 37075291 Indian Lake Blvd
Open until 6:00 pm
  • Mon 8:00 am - 6:00 pm
  • Tue 8:00 am - 6:00 pm
  • Wed 8:00 am - 6:00 pm
  • Thu 8:00 am - 6:00 pm
  • Fri 8:00 am - 6:00 pm
  • Sat 8:00 am - 6:00 pm
  • Sun 8:00 am - 6:00 pm
4.1(129 reviews)
AFC Urgent Care, Hendersonville - 291 Indian Lake Blvd, Hendersonville
Visit Clinic

280 Indian Lake Blvd, Hendersonville, TN 37075280 Indian Lake Blvd
Open until 8:00 pm
  • Mon 8:00 am - 8:00 pm
  • Tue 8:00 am - 8:00 pm
  • Wed 8:00 am - 8:00 pm
  • Thu 8:00 am - 8:00 pm
  • Fri 8:00 am - 8:00 pm
  • Sat 8:00 am - 7:00 pm
  • Sun 8:00 am - 7:00 pm
4.81(42 reviews)
This clinic is rated highly in patient reviews and ratings

Highly Rated

CareNow Urgent Care, Hendersonville - 280 Indian Lake Blvd, Hendersonville
I was seen in this clinic for the very first time and couldn’t have asked for a better experience. Time from checking in to be moved to a room was minimal and all of the staff was very personable and polite. Waiting time to see a provider was also short considering the amount of patients that were in the waiting room. Will definitely be using this clinic again when needed.
Visit Clinic

620 S Mt Juliet Rd, Mt. Juliet, TN 37122620 S Mt Juliet Rd
Open until 8:00 pm
  • Mon 8:00 am - 8:00 pm
  • Tue 8:00 am - 8:00 pm
  • Wed 8:00 am - 8:00 pm
  • Thu 8:00 am - 8:00 pm
  • Fri 8:00 am - 8:00 pm
  • Sat 8:00 am - 7:00 pm
  • Sun 8:00 am - 7:00 pm
CareNow Urgent Care, Mt. Juliet - 620 S Mt Juliet Rd
Visit Clinic

206 Crossings Ln, Mt. Juliet, TN 37122206 Crossings Ln
Open until10:00 pm
  • Mon 8:00 am - 10:00 pm
  • Tue 8:00 am - 10:00 pm
  • Wed 8:00 am - 10:00 pm
  • Thu 8:00 am - 10:00 pm
  • Fri 8:00 am - 10:00 pm
  • Sat 9:00 am - 6:00 pm
  • Sun10:00 am - 6:00 pm
Visit Clinic

355 Pleasant Grove Rd, Mount Juliet, TN 37122355 Pleasant Grove Rd
Open until 6:00 pm
  • Mon 8:00 am - 6:00 pm
  • Tue 8:00 am - 6:00 pm
  • Wed 8:00 am - 6:00 pm
  • Thu 8:00 am - 6:00 pm
  • Fri 8:00 am - 6:00 pm
  • Sat 8:00 am - 6:00 pm
  • Sun 8:00 am - 6:00 pm
3.7(74 reviews)
AFC Urgent Care, Mount-Juliet - 355 Pleasant Grove Rd, Mount Juliet
Visit Clinic

2025 N Mt Juliet Rd, Mount Juliet, TN 371222025 N Mt Juliet Rd
Open until 9:30 pm
  • Mon 6:00 pm - 9:30 pm
  • Tue 6:00 pm - 9:30 pm
  • Wed 6:00 pm - 9:30 pm
  • Thu 6:00 pm - 9:30 pm
  • Fri 6:00 pm - 9:30 pm
  • Sat 3:00 pm - 9:30 pm
  • Sun12:00 pm - 7:30 pm
Visit Clinic

401 S Mt Juliet Rd, Mt. Juliet, TN 37122401 S Mt Juliet Rd
Open until 7:00 pm
  • Mon 9:00 am - 7:00 pm
  • Tue 9:00 am - 7:00 pm
  • Wed 9:00 am - 7:00 pm
  • Thu 9:00 am - 7:00 pm
  • Fri 9:00 am - 7:00 pm
  • Sat 9:00 am - 6:00 pm
  • Sun10:00 am - 6:00 pm
CVS Pharmacy, Inside Target - 401 S Mt Juliet Rd
Visit Clinic

754 N Mt Juliet Rd, Mount Juliet, TN 37122754 N Mt Juliet Rd
3.67(3 reviews)
This clinic is rated highly in reviews for their clean offices

Sparkling Clean

Awesome place. Nurse Dallas was the best
Visit Clinic

2302 Madison St, Clarksville, TN 370432302 Madison St
Open until 8:00 pm
  • Mon 8:00 am - 8:00 pm
  • Tue 8:00 am - 8:00 pm
  • Wed 8:00 am - 8:00 pm
  • Thu 8:00 am - 8:00 pm
  • Fri 8:00 am - 8:00 pm
  • Sat 9:00 am - 5:00 pm
  • Sun12:00 pm - 6:00 pm
2.5(6 reviews)
Visit Clinic

1332 Hazelwood Dr, Smyrna, TN 371671332 Hazelwood Dr
Open until 5:00 pm
  • Mon 8:00 am - 5:00 pm
  • Tue 8:00 am - 5:00 pm
  • Wed 8:00 am - 5:00 pm
  • Thu 8:00 am - 5:00 pm
  • Fri 8:00 am - 5:00 pm
  • SatClosed
  • SunClosed
Visit Clinic

1300 Hazelwood Dr, Smyrna, TN 371671300 Hazelwood Dr
Open until 5:00 pm
  • Mon 9:30 am - 5:00 pm
  • Tue 9:30 am - 5:00 pm
  • Wed 9:30 am - 5:00 pm
  • Thu 9:30 am - 5:00 pm
  • Fri 9:30 am - 5:00 pm
  • Sat 9:30 am - 5:00 pm
  • Sun10:30 am - 5:00 pm
Visit Clinic

4120 N Mt Juliet Rd, Mount Juliet, TN 371224120 N Mt Juliet Rd
5.0(1 reviews)
This clinic has shorter than average waiting periods

Short Wait Time

The Little Clinic at Kroger - 4120 N Mt Juliet Rd, Mount Juliet
Visit Clinic

11563 Old Nashville Hwy, Smyrna, TN 3716711563 Old Nashville Hwy
Open until 9:00 pm
  • Mon 9:00 am - 9:00 pm
  • Tue 9:00 am - 9:00 pm
  • Wed 9:00 am - 9:00 pm
  • Thu 9:00 am - 9:00 am
  • Fri 9:00 am - 9:00 pm
  • Sat 9:00 am - 6:00 pm
  • Sun10:00 am - 6:00 pm
CVS Pharmacy - 11563 Old Nashville Hwy
Visit Clinic

121 Mayfield Dr, Smyrna, TN 37167121 Mayfield Dr
Open until 5:00 pm
  • Mon 8:00 am - 5:00 pm
  • Tue 8:00 am - 5:00 pm
  • Wed 8:00 am - 5:00 pm
  • Thu 8:00 am - 5:00 pm
  • Fri 8:00 am - 5:00 pm
  • SatClosed
  • SunClosed
Internal Medicine Associates - 121 Mayfield Dr, Smyrna
Visit Clinic

11185 Lebanon Rd, Mt. Juliet, TN 3712211185 Lebanon Rd
Open until 5:00 pm
  • Mon 9:30 am - 5:00 pm
  • Tue 9:30 am - 5:00 pm
  • Wed 9:30 am - 5:00 pm
  • Thu 9:30 am - 5:00 pm
  • Fri 9:30 am - 5:00 pm
  • Sat 9:30 am - 5:00 pm
  • Sun10:30 am - 5:00 pm
Visit Clinic

1954 Madison St, Clarksville, TN 370431954 Madison St
Open until 7:30 pm
  • Mon 8:00 am - 7:30 pm
  • Tue 8:00 am - 7:30 pm
  • Wed 8:00 am - 7:30 pm
  • Thu 8:00 am - 7:30 pm
  • Fri 8:00 am - 7:30 pm
  • Sat 8:30 am - 4:00 pm
  • Sun 8:30 am - 4:00 pm
Walgreens - 1954 Madison St, Clarksville
Visit Clinic

1763 Madison St, Clarksville, TN 370431763 Madison St
Open until 6:00 pm
  • Mon 8:00 am - 6:00 pm
  • Tue 8:00 am - 6:00 pm
  • Wed 8:00 am - 6:00 pm
  • Thu 8:00 am - 6:00 pm
  • Fri 8:00 am - 6:00 pm
  • Sat 8:00 am - 6:00 pm
  • Sun 8:00 am - 6:00 pm
3.66(215 reviews)
AFC Urgent Care, Clarksville - 1763 Madison St, Clarksville
Excellent care. Dr. Niner and the staff are always great. They have helped me tremendously.
Visit Clinic
Add location icon

Own a clinic? Add your location.

Help patients book appointments with you on Solv. It's free!

Add location

This site uses cookies to provide you with a great user experience. By using Solv, you accept our use of cookies.